Conveyor Technique in Transition: What’s Coming in 2025, What’s Here to Stay
Even in 2025, conveyor technique remains shaped by rapid technological advancements. While proven technologies continue to thrive, the demand for efficiency, sustainability, and automation is driving the industry forward.
What’s here to stay in 2025:
Traditional systems like roller conveyors and chain conveyors maintain their critical role, especially in heavy-duty industrial applications. Their reliability and durability are irreplaceable. Modular system designs also remain highly sought after, offering the flexibility to adapt to evolving production needs.
What’s transforming conveyor technique in 2025:
Digital transformation is redefining the landscape. Smart systems equipped with sensors and IoT (Internet of Things) provide real-time data for predictive maintenance and optimized material flow. Driverless transport systems (DTS) will continue to grow, especially in warehouse logistics and production environments.
Sustainability remains a top priority, driven by both economic and environmental factors. Conveyor systems are becoming more energy-efficient and eco-friendly, with manufacturers increasingly using recyclable materials and renewable energy sources.
Another milestone shaping material handling in 2025 is the integration of artificial intelligence (AI). Autonomous management and optimization of complex logistics chains are central goals. AI-driven simulations further enhance processes during the planning phase.
The future of material handling combines modularity, robustness, and innovation.
